Golden Entertainment, Inc. (NASDAQ:GDEN - Get Free Report)'s stock price crossed below its 50-day moving average during trading on Tuesday . The stock has a 50-day moving average of $27.95 and traded as low as $26.16. Golden Entertainment shares last traded at $26.62, with a volume of 115,031 shares changing hands.

Golden Entertainment (NASDAQ:GDEN - Get Free Report) last released its earnings results on Friday, February 27th. The company reported ($0.01) ear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, missing analysts' consensus estimates of $0.11 by ($0.12). Golden Entertainment had a positive return on equity of 0.51% and a negative net margin of 0.95%.The firm had revenue of $155.63 million for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$166.61 million. As a group, equities research analysts predict that Golden Entertainment, Inc. will post 0.2 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Golden Entertainment Dividend Announcement

The company also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Wednesday, April 1st. Investors of record on Wednesday, March 18th will be issued a dividend of $0.25 per share. The ex-dividend date is Wednesday, March 18th. This represents a $1.00 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 3.8%. Golden Entertainment's dividend payout ratio (DPR) is presently -400.00%.

Golden Entertainment, Inc is a diversified gaming and hospitality company that operates in the casino, tavern-casino and slot route markets. The company's core activities encompass the ownership and management of full-service resort casinos, a portfolio of branded neighborhood tavern-casinos and a large slot distribution network. Headquartered in Summerlin, Nevada, Golden Entertainment serves leisure and local gaming customers across multiple Western U.S. markets.

In its casino and tavern-casino segment, Golden Entertainment owns and operates properties such as Bronco Billy's Casino & Hotel in Cripple Creek, Colorado, along with a collection of PT's branded venues throughout Southern Nevada.
